Algorithm for rapid drug development created in St. Petersburg.
Specialists from ITMO University in St. Petersburg have developed an algorithm that utilizes artificial intelligence to generate pharmaceutical cocrystals, which form the basis of future medicinal drugs. This innovative technology promises to expedite and reduce the cost of the drug development process while improving the procedure of creating dosage forms, particularly the process of compressing the drug substance into a tablet.
Currently, the algorithm is presented as Python code, but in the future, developers plan to create a website or application based on it. Additionally, in the long term, there are plans to broaden the range of properties the algorithm can predict and adapt it to other chemical systems.
Pharmaceutical cocrystals, consisting of a drug molecule and a coformer (an auxiliary molecule), play a crucial role in altering the physicochemical properties of medicinal compounds.
